Just incase you dont have enough stuff a chrono is really nice. I bought one twenty years ago for $90. and I think they are still about the same for the non printer versions. I was getting 800 fps from a Combat Commander LTWT from white box ammo. The funny thing was I thought It was always 800 FPS. On average each shot can go + or- 25 fps. Doesnt really matter at the muzzle but when you start rainbow shooting at 100 yards plus you really start looking at the flatter shooting 185 gr green and gold boxes, then you start looking at faster and slower powders, then you start measuring your bullet seating and then you start playing with different primer lots, and then you start looking at different barrels, and new shooting coaches, and more bench space for your trophies... And then you remember you just bought the gun for protection and didnt realize how many options were opening up. Chronos are fun though and you never have to take any written word as gospel again.
